Performance of Top Cat Games in El Salvador Q4 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top five cat games on a unified platform in El Salvador during Q4 2025, based on Sensor Tower data.
In the fourth quarter of 2025, the top cat-themed games on a unified platform in El Salvador showcased varying tr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a closer look at how each app performed during this period.
My Talking Tom 2 saw its weekly revenue peak at approximately $99 in late November, with downloads peaking mid-quarter at around 7.8K. The app maintained a strong user base, with active users fluctuating between 53K and 78K.
My Talking Angela 2 experienced a peak in weekly revenue of roughly $151 during early December. Downloads peaked at the end of December, reaching 4.8K, while active users ranged from 36K to 43K throughout the quarter.
My Talking Tom had a consistent performance with a revenue peak of $38 at the end of December and saw downloads rise to 3.9K in the same week. Active users showed a gradual increase from 25K to 28K.
My Talking Tom Friends achieved its highest weekly revenue of $101 in mid-October. Weekly downloads reached a high of 5.2K in late November, with active users peaking at 33K.
Finally, My Talking Tom Friends 2 reported its top revenue of $25 in late October. Downloads varied, with a peak in early October at 3.3K, while active users increased steadily, reaching over 11K by mid-November.
